2025年数据库技术深度对比:关系型与非关系型核心差异全解析
在数字化时代,数据库作为数据管理基石,关系型(如MySQL)与非关系型(如MongoDB)数据库呈现根本性差异。本文基于2025年技术前沿,深入剖析其核心分野,助力企业精准选型。
数据模型:结构化与灵活性的博弈
关系型数据库采用严格的关系模型,数据以二维表形式存储,字段类型、约束及表间关联(如主键/外键)确保ACID事务一致性。例如,用户表需预定义用户名、年龄等字段,保障数据完整性但牺牲灵活性。非关系型数据库则支持动态模型:文档型(MongoDB)以JSON-like文档存储异构数据;键值型(Redis)简化至键值对,适用于半结构化场景如实时日志处理。
存储架构:磁盘持久化与内存分布式优化
关系型数据库依赖磁盘存储与B+树索引,易受I/O瓶颈制约高并发场景(如电商峰值交易)。非关系型方案多样化:Redis利用内存存储实现微秒级响应,Cassandra通过分布式架构水平扩展。企业部署时,需匹配服务器资源——高性能服务器如海外服务器租用指南推荐的配置,可优化Redis内存需求。
扩展性与性能:垂直局限与水平弹性
关系型数据库扩展受限于垂直升级(如CPU/内存增强),而NoSQL如HBase支持无缝水平扩展。结合服务器优化策略,选用弹性云服务(IaaS/PaaS)可应对TB级数据增长。
查询语言与事务机制:SQL规范与NoSQL多样性
SQL提供标准化CRUD操作(如SELECT * FROM users WHERE age>25),NoSQL则因数据库而异:MongoDB使用JavaScript式查询,Redis依赖KEYS命令。事务层面,关系型严格遵循ACID(原子性/隔离性),非关系型多采用BASE模型(最终一致性),需搭配免费SSL证书强化网站安全。
2025年选型策略与服务器部署建议
金融系统宜选关系型保障事务安全;大数据分析场景倾向NoSQL高吞吐。部署时参考服务器选择指南:关系型需SSD磁盘与多核CPU,NoSQL优先大内存配置。企业级服务器如Cisco系列可提升系统鲁棒性。
综上,理解CAP定理权衡(一致性/可用性/分区容忍)是关键。2025年9月3日,结合业务需求选择数据库,并优化服务器架构,方能实现高效数据治理。
文章对ACID与BASE模型的对比存在概念模糊,混淆了CAP定理中“一致性”与“可用性”的权衡逻辑;引述的“性能基准”缺乏可复现的测试环境说明,实验数据可信度存疑,技术论证流于表面。